Cow rescued from slurry pit

Firefighters were called on to rescue a cow which had wandered into a slurry pit. The animal had got itself stuck in the 5ft deep pit on a farm in Broughton Road, Stoney Stanton. Crews from Hinckley and the fire service's technical rescue team from Leicester attended the incident at just before 9am today (SAT). They used an inflatable "rescue path" to reach the stranded cow and attached harnesses before pulling it to safety with the help of a digger. The whole operation took about an hour to complete. A fire service spokeswoman said: "The cow was successfully freed and left with the farmer. "It was obviously distressing for the animal but it was otherwise unhurt."
